    Installing Umbraco locally using WebMatrix beta 3 - how to?

    Hi there

    I'm trying to install Umbraco locally, using the great tool WebMatrix beta 3 from Microsoft. It really seems like a great tool to test/migrate local IIS sites, without killing my local machine ressources.

    Here is what I do:

    1. Start Webmatrix
    2. Choose a directory for new WebMatrix website, containing an Umbraco Build
    3. Create new dataabse from "New database" in Webmatrix
    4. Start website - which starts Umbraco installer, that works fine
    5. ...and the it (as always) asks for an database connection.
    My problem is, that I cant figure out if I can use the Database in WebMatrix (Microsoft SQL Server Compact database) - creating a local sdf file, since I simply can't find any database user/password/setup/connections settings, in WebMatrix
    Usually use Local IIS and SQL express, which works just fine. I'm not a super techie, sooo :o)
